Frankie and Johnny movie plot

2022-01-13 08:02
Frankie is a waitress at a small cheap restaurant in New York. Johnny is a middle-aged man sentenced to one and a half years in prison for fraud. He has just been released after serving his sentence and came to New York to look for work. He was taken in by the restaurant’s kind owner Nick and became a fast food chef. Johnny became interested in Frankie and wanted to ask her out for a walk. Frankie refused, but Johnny appeared in her apartment again, saying that he wanted to accompany her to the party. At the party, Johnny stayed with Frankie and kindly joked with her. Later, he took her home on foot. The friendship between them turned into eroticism. As a result, Johnny stayed at her home for the whole night. But when he returned to work in the restaurant, Frankie began to hate Johnny for showing her every kind of hospitality and lost interest in him. He felt uneasy. Finally, Frankie admitted to him that a past boyfriend had caused her emotional and physical trauma, and she has not fully recovered yet. So John solemnly proposed to Frankie, and they gained mutual trust and understanding. She finally found a place for Johnny deep in her heart and at home.
